Probability of solving specific problem independently by A and B are `(1)/(2)` and 3`(1)/(3)` respectively. If both try to solve the problem independently, find the probability that
(i) the problem is solved (ii) exactly one of them solves the problem.

Text Solution

Verified by Experts

The correct Answer is:
`(i)(2)/(3), (ii) (1)/(2)`
